Visit the Sarawak Cultural Village

Sarawak Cultural Village

The Sarawak Cultural Village or oftern called as the "Living Museum", located at the foot of Mount Santubong, provides a unique opportunity to explore the multicultural heritage of Sarawak.

Covering 17 acres, this living museum showcases traditional longhouses and various styles of residences representing the seven major ethnic groups in Sarawak. 

Witness artisans crafting traditional items and enjoy captivating dance and music performances that celebrate the rich cultural heritage of the region.

Visit Fort Margherita

Fort Margherita

Fort Margherita, located by the Kuching River, is a small British castle that holds significant historical value. Built in 1879, this castle was a key defense against pirate invasions and witnessed the history of the Brooke Dynasty in Sarawak. 

It is used as the police museum after the fort's exterior has been completely renovated.

See Orangutans at Semenggoh Wildlife Centre

Semenggoh Wildlife Centre

It is located around 30 minutes from the city, Semenggoh Wildlife Centre is the one of the best places in Malaysia to see semi-wild orangutans.

But remember that every sightseeing is depends on orangutans to choose to come out from the forest.

Visit during feeding sessions for the highest chance of spotting:

Best Time to Visit Kuching

Royal Kuching River Cruise Experience with Light Refreshments & Free Flow Drink

Season

Weather

Best For

March to October

Relatively drier

Sightseeing and national parks

November to February

Rainier season

Museums, food tours, indoor attractions
